Not only is the concrete absorbing the water from above, but it’s also taking on the runoff from the areas around it. 2. Groundwater. The concrete slab can also absorb the groundwater below and around it. Thus, the amount of natural groundwater greatly impacts concrete moisture conditions. 3. Unnatural Sources.

Ployethylene is the material that makes up the concrete vapor barrier. This is laid on top of concrete in the building process so that moisture does not get through. Concrete vapor barriers should not be less than 10 mils thick and the thicker the better. This will help keep it from puncturing. Silica fume also acts as filler due to its ultra-fine particle size resulting in improved moisture barrier properties of concrete. Oxides of silica fume reacts with calcium hydroxide (CH) and produces additional calcium silicate hydrate (C S H) which fills the pores resulting in increased strength and smaller pore size …Moisture Vapor Barrier.
